WordPress

How to Make a Social Media Website (Beginner’s Guide)

Do you need to make a social media web site?

Making a social media web site permits you to present a platform for customers to share information, updates, and opinions on varied matters. It will probably construct a way of group amongst customers with shared pursuits and enhance engagement with discussions and boards.

On this article, we are going to present you easy methods to simply make a social media web site in WordPress, step-by-step.

Make a Social Media Website

Earlier than You Begin: Create a Social Media Web site Guidelines

Earlier than beginning your social media web site, you must first fastidiously plan the options and ideas that you really want your social platform to incorporate.

First, you must select the kind of social media web site that you can be creating. For instance, you may make a media-sharing web site like Instagram or knowledgeable business site like Glassdoor.

You can additionally create an informational discussion board website like Quora or a social community website like Fb.

After you have provide you with an concept, you must undergo the next guidelines to create a foolproof plan in your web site:

  • Goal Viewers: Identify your target audience primarily based on age group, location, and conduct.
  • Developments and Preferences: Study user trends for the area of interest you will have chosen and attempt to discover options that your target market will discover helpful.
  • Analysis Authorized Elements: Guarantee your platform complies with information privateness, mental property, and different related legal guidelines. This may imply speaking to a lawyer.
  • Rent a Developer: After you have finished your analysis, you may simply rent a developer to construct a social media web site for you. We advocate going with Seahawk Media Services to get an Search engine optimization-ready web site very quickly.

Nonetheless, in the event you don’t need to hire a developer, then you too can construct a social media web site by your self with none coding required.

Observe: This text is about making a social media web site. If you wish to embed social media feeds from platforms like Fb or Instagram in your present web site, then you should use the Smash Balloon plugin. For particulars, please see our tutorial on how to add your social media feeds to WordPress.

Having stated that, let’s check out easy methods to simply make a social media web site, step-by-step:

Step 1: Select a Web site Builder

WordPress is the best website builder to make a social media platform as a result of it’s tremendous simple to make use of, scalable, and has highly effective options. Plus, it powers over 43% of the websites on the web.

It’s utilized by many companies, online stores, and social media web sites for information and updates, making a group, leisure, and advertising.

Nonetheless, needless to say there are two forms of WordPress on the web.

WordPress.com is a weblog internet hosting platform, whereas WordPress.org is an open-source, self-hosted software program. For extra detailed data, you’ll be able to see our comparison between WordPress.com and WordPress.org.

To create a social media web site, we advocate choosing WordPress.org as a result of it’s utterly free, can combine with quite a few WordPress plugins, and provides you full management over your web site.

For extra data, chances are you’ll prefer to see our WordPress.org review.

Now that you’ve chosen a web site builder, it’s time to start out constructing your web site.

Step 2: Select a Area Title and Internet hosting for Your Social Media Web site

To create a WordPress website, you’ll first have to buy a site title and a internet hosting plan.

domain name will probably be your social media platform’s title on the web. It’s what clients will sort of their browsers to go to your web site, like www.socialmediawebsite.com or www.sociallysavvy.com.

Equally, webhosting is the place your web site lives on-line. To search out the proper webhosting in your social media website, you’ll be able to see our full checklist of the best WordPress hosting services.

You’ll now discover that despite the fact that WordPress is free, that is the place your prices will begin including up. A website title will price you about $14.99/12 months whereas internet hosting prices begin from $7.99/month.

This generally is a bit costly when you’ve got a small funds or are simply beginning.

Fortunately, Bluehost is providing a HUGE low cost to WPBeginner readers together with a free area title and an SSL certificate. They’re one of many largest corporations on the planet and an official WordPress-recommended internet hosting accomplice.

To get a reduction, you’ll be able to simply click on on the next button:

It will direct you to the Bluehost website, the place you will need to click on the ‘Get Began Now’ button.

Clicking the Get Started Now button in the Bluehost page

When you try this, you can be taken to the pricing web page, the place you will need to choose a internet hosting plan in keeping with your social media web site’s necessities.

We advocate choosing the Fundamental or Selection Plus plan as a result of they’re the preferred webhosting plans amongst our readers. Upon making a selection, simply click on the ‘Choose’ button beneath a plan.

Bluehost Pricing Plans

You’ll now be taken to a brand new web page, the place you will need to select a site title in your social media platform.

We advocate choosing a reputation that’s associated to your area of interest and is straightforward to spell, pronounce, and keep in mind. For concepts, you’ll be able to see our newbie’s information on how to choose the best domain name.

Nonetheless, in case you are nonetheless confused and should not have a reputation in your social media platform but, then you too can strive WPBeginner’s Free Business Name Generator to provide you with an ideal title.

After typing within the title, simply click on on the ‘Subsequent’ button to proceed.

Add a name for your social media website

It will take you to the subsequent step, the place you will need to present your account data, telephone quantity, business email address, title, and nation.

When you try this, additionally, you will see elective extras that you may purchase.

We typically don’t advocate shopping for these extras right away, as you’ll be able to at all times add them later if your enterprise wants them.

Bluehost package extras

Subsequent, sort in your fee data to buy the internet hosting plan.

Upon doing that, you’ll obtain a affirmation electronic mail with particulars to log in to your Bluehost dashboard. This will probably be your management panel the place you’ll be able to simply handle your social media web site.

Now, it’s time so that you can set up WordPress.

Step 3: Create a New WordPress Web site

In case you signed up on Bluehost utilizing our link above, then WordPress will routinely be put in in your area title for you.

Nonetheless, if you wish to create a distinct WordPress website in your social media platform, then you will need to change to the ‘Web sites’ tab within the Bluehost dashboard.

As soon as you’re there, click on the ‘Add Web site’ button.

Click the Add Site button on the Bluehost dashboard

It will take you to a brand new display screen, the place it’s a must to choose a website sort. To create a totally new WordPress website, click on the ‘Set up WordPress’ choice.

Alternatively, emigrate an present website to a distinct area title, you’ll be able to select the ‘Switch an present WordPress’ choice. After that, click on the ‘Proceed’ button.

Choose a site type

Within the subsequent step, you’ll be able to add a reputation in your social media web site in keeping with your liking.

Then, click on ‘Proceed’ to maneuver forward.

Add a site title for your social media website

Bluehost will now ask you to hook up with a site title in your social media platform.

Nonetheless, in the event you haven’t bought one but, then you’ll be able to go for the ‘Use a brief area’ choice within the meantime.

Choose a domain name for your social media website

After that, click on the ‘Proceed’ button. Bluehost will now set up and arrange your WordPress website for you, which might take a couple of minutes.

As soon as that’s completed, you can be redirected to the ‘Web sites’ tab, the place you will see your newly created WordPress website.

Right here, merely click on the ‘Edit Web site’ button to log in to your WordPress admin space.

Click the Edit Site button to access your WordPress dashboard

You too can log in to your WordPress dashboard by visiting yoursite.com/wp-admin/ within the internet browser. Simply be certain that to switch yoursite.com with your individual area title.

Step 4: Choose a Theme for Your Social Media Web site

When you go to your WordPress web site, you’ll discover that it presently has the default theme activated.

A theme is a professionally designed template that controls how your web site seems to your guests.

Twenty Twenty Four default theme

To get extra guests to your web site and generate leads, it’s a good suggestion to switch the default theme with one which matches your social media web site’s area of interest.

For instance, you’ll be able to set up any of the popular WordPress themes and customise them in keeping with your liking.

You too can use themes which can be particularly designed for social media web sites. For concepts, you’ll be able to see our checklist of the best WordPress BuddyPress themes.

BuddyPress is an excellent widespread plugin that’s used to make social media networks and web sites. The truth is, we are going to present you easy methods to use it afterward on this tutorial.

In case you need assistance putting in your chosen theme, then you’ll be able to see our newbie’s information on how to install a WordPress theme.

Upon activation, go to the Look » Customise web page from the WordPress admin sidebar to edit the theme in keeping with your liking.

Customize your social media site theme

Understand that in case you are utilizing a block theme, then you will need to go to the Look » Editor web page from the WordPress dashboard to open the full site editor.

Right here, you’ll be able to drag and drop the blocks from the left column to customise your web site. As soon as you’re finished, don’t overlook to click on the ‘Save’ button to retailer your settings.

Choose a block theme for social media website

Step 5: Set Up Your Social Media Web site With BuddyPress

By default, WordPress doesn’t have a built-in performance to create a social media web site. That’s the reason we advocate utilizing BuddyPress.

It’s a widespread and free WordPress plugin that may remodel your website right into a social community in only a few minutes.

First, you might want to set up and activate the BuddyPress plugin. For detailed directions, see our step-by-step information on how to install a WordPress plugin.

Upon activation, you might want to go to the Settings » BuddyPress web page out of your WordPress dashboard. It will open the parts web page, which can present all of the BuddyPress options which can be activated by default.

Right here, you’ll be able to select the options that you simply need to add to your social media web site. For instance, if you would like customers to have the ability to observe one another like on Instagram, then you’ll be able to verify the ‘Pal Connections’ choice.

You too can select the ‘Personal Messaging’ choice to permit customers to contact one another privately like on Fb.

Moreover, you’ll be able to choose the ‘Person Teams’ choice to permit customers to create personal or public teams for various actions and discussions.

Select BuddyPress components from the list

After you have chosen the parts so as to add to your social media web site, don’t overlook to click on the ‘Save Settings’ button to retailer your adjustments.

Subsequent, change to the ‘URLs’ tab. Right here, you’ll be able to configure the slugs and titles for the pages that will probably be created with BuddyPress.

For instance, if you wish to name the members of your website ‘customers’, then you’ll be able to add that slug subsequent to the ‘Listing Slug’ choice after increasing the ‘Members’ tab.

Understand that you received’t have the ability to edit the permalinks created by the plugin. As soon as you’re finished, click on the ‘Save Settings’ button.

Add slugs and titles for buddypress pages

Now change to the ‘Choices’ tab, the place you can begin by selecting if you wish to present the toolbar to logged-in customers or not.

After that, you will need to set your group visibility to ‘Anybody’ if you would like any customer to have the ability to view the social media exercise in your web site.

Choose customization options for social media websites

You may then additionally choose if you wish to allow users to delete their accounts, add profile images, or cowl photographs. You too can permit customers to ask different folks to affix your group.

Then, go forward and click on the ‘Save Settings’ button to retailer your settings.

Allow profile photo uploads for members

Now BuddyPress will routinely create a Members and Exercise Streams web page in your web site.

That is how the Exercise web page regarded on our demo web site.

Activity page preview on social media website

Customers will now have the ability to create their profiles, add cowl photographs, ship good friend requests, and add profile images in your social media web site.

Here’s a preview of a profile web page on our demo web site.

Profile page preview

You too can handle completely different customers registering in your website by visiting the Exercise menu tab from the WordPress dashboard.

Right here, you’ll be able to maintain a log of all of the actions being carried out by customers. You too can edit the motion, delete it, or mark it as spam from right here.

Activity page on your WordPress dashboard

You may handle new signups by visiting the Customers » Handle Signups tab from the admin sidebar.

As soon as you’re there, you’ll be able to activate an account, ship an electronic mail for verification, or delete it in keeping with your liking.

Manage signups

In order for you, you too can add completely different profile fields for customers, add member varieties, create teams, and handle electronic mail notifications proper out of your WordPress dashboard.

For extra detailed directions on these options, you’ll be able to see our tutorial on how to turn your WordPress site into a social network.

Step 6: Use bbPress to Create a Discussion board (Non-obligatory)

It is usually a good suggestion so as to add a discussion board to your social media web site.

It will permit customers to start out dialog threads and share their ideas on completely different matters with one another. This may be nice for reinforcing engagement and motivating different customers to enroll in your web site.

You may simply create a discussion board with bbPress as a result of it’s the best WordPress forum plugin available on the market. Plus, the plugin is totally free, making it an ideal selection.

bbPress

Upon plugin activation, merely go to the Boards » Add New web page from the WordPress dashboard and add a reputation for the discussion board that you’re creating.

After that, you’ll be able to add an outline and configure the visibility to public, personal, or registered customers solely.

Create a new forum

As soon as you’re finished, simply click on the ‘Publish’ button to make your discussion board dwell.

With bbPress, you too can average the discussion board, add a ranking system, create classes, and set up completely different boards as wanted.

For detailed directions, please see our tutorial on how to add a forum in WordPress.

Step 7: Create a Navigation Menu and Homepage

Now that you’ve arrange your social media web site and created pages for it, it is very important add these hyperlinks to the navigation menu. It will permit customers to simply discover all of the pages they want in your website.

To do that, go to the Look » Menus web page from the WordPress dashboard and increase the ‘BuddyPress Member’ tab within the left column.

From right here, verify the choices for all of the pages that you simply need to add to the navigation menu and click on the ‘Add to menu’ button.

Add BuddyPress pages to navigation menu

After that, click on the ‘Save Menu’ button to retailer your settings.

If you’re utilizing a block theme, then you’ll have to go to the Look » Editor web page from the WordPress dashboard as an alternative.

It will open the complete website editor, the place you will need to select the ‘Navigation’ tab.

Choose the Navigation option

It will open a listing of all of the navigation menu objects within the sidebar on the left.

Right here, merely click on on the ‘Edit’ button.

Click the Edit button to edit the navigation menu

Now, the complete website editor will probably be launched on the display screen with the navigation menu settings opened up within the block panel.

From right here, click on the ‘+’ button and choose the ‘Customized Hyperlink’ block.

Add the custom link block in the navigation menu

A customized hyperlink will now be added to your navigation menu, and a immediate will open up within the block panel on the fitting.

Right here, merely sort ‘BuddyPress’ into the search field to view all of the pages created by the plugin. You may then select the one you need to add to your web site’s menu.

Add the BuddyPress pages in the full site editor

Lastly, click on the ‘Save’ button on the high to retailer your settings. For extra particulars, see our tutorial on how to add a navigation menu in WordPress.

Subsequent, you may additionally need to add a beautiful homepage to your social media website. This web page will probably be your website’s introduction to customers so chances are you’ll need to make it visually interesting.

To create a beautiful web page, you’ll be able to see our tutorial on how to create a custom home page in WordPress.

Social media site home page

After you have completed designing the web page, you’ll be able to set it as your social media website’s homepage by visiting the Settings » Studying web page out of your WordPress dashboard.

Right here, choose the ‘A static web page’ choice within the ‘Your homepage shows’ part. Subsequent, open the ‘Homepage’ dropdown and select the web page you need to use.

Choose a static home page

After that, don’t overlook to click on the ‘Save Adjustments’ button to retailer your settings.

Step 8: Use WPForms to Add a Contact Type

After you have arrange your social media web site, it’s time to add a contact type. This kind permits customers to contact you if they’ve any queries and might enhance engagement.

So as to add a contact type, you should use WPForms, which is the best WordPress contact form plugin available on the market.

WPForms floating footer bar preview

It comes with a drag-and-drop builder, 1400+ premade templates, full spam safety, and extra.

First, you will have to put in and activate the WPForms plugin. For particulars, see our tutorial on how to install a WordPress plugin.

Upon activation, you should use the ‘Easy Contact Type’ template after which add it to any web page or put up utilizing the WPForms block.

For detailed data, you’ll be able to try our tutorial on how to create a contact form in WordPress.

Add the WPForms block for the online order form

Aside from a contact type, you too can add a enterprise telephone service to your social media platform to enhance the client expertise.

This manner, customers can simply attain out to you for time-sensitive points or in the event that they need to report an inappropriate incident in your platform instantly.

You may simply add a enterprise telephone service utilizing Nextiva, which is the best phone service for small businesses. It’s simple to make use of, presents a simple setup, has quite a lot of options, and has cheap pricing, making it an ideal selection.

Nextiva's homepage

Moreover, you too can use the platform for on-line faxing, dwell chat, on-line surveys, CRM, name analytics, and extra.

For detailed directions, see our tutorial on how to set up an auto-attendant phone system for your website.

Step 9: Use All in One Search engine optimization to Enhance Web site Rankings

Now that you’ve created a social media web site, it is very important enhance its search engine rankings. This may carry extra site visitors to the platform, improve model consciousness, and finally allow you to develop your social community.

We advocate utilizing All in One Seo for WordPress.

It’s the best SEO plugin available on the market that comes with an incredible and beginner-friendly setup wizard that can assist you select the most effective Search engine optimization settings for your enterprise. 

All in One SEO

Moreover, it has options like an on-page Search engine optimization guidelines, XML sitemaps, a damaged hyperlink checker, a schema generator, and extra.

You too can add FAQs and their schema, observe particular person key phrase outcomes, do picture Search engine optimization, and use the link assistant function to additional optimize your web site.

AIOSEO additionally integrates with different social media networks like Fb and Twitter and optimizes your content material for social media sharing.

For extra particulars, you’ll be able to see our complete WordPress SEO guide.

Bonus Instruments to Enhance Your Social Media Web site

Listed here are some bonus instruments that you should use in your social media web site to spice up conversions, get extra guests, and become profitable out of your website:

We hope this text helped you discover ways to create a social media web site in WordPress. You might also need to see our newbie’s information on how to create an intranet for small businesses with WordPress and our high picks for the best plugins to convert a WordPress site into a mobile app.

In case you appreciated this text, then please subscribe to our YouTube Channel for WordPress video tutorials. You too can discover us on Twitter and Facebook.



Leave a Reply

Your email address will not be published. Required fields are marked *